## Who Owns the Autoscaler

Welcome aboard! The queue-depth autoscaler (internally "Stacker") watches the depth of the Pelham ingest queues and scales worker pods up or down every 90 seconds. It lives in `infra/stacker/` and yes, the config YAML is crankier than it looks — change one threshold and three alarms wake up. Before touching scaling policies, thresholds, or the cooldown window, read `TUNING.md` and then check in with the owner. All config changes need a thumbs-up from the person listed below.

named custodian: Oliath Ralax

## Farewatch Environments

Quick rundown for the security review: the Farewatch ticket-pricing experiment runs in three environments — sandbox, staging, and prod-canary. Only prod-canary touches live fares, and it's capped at 5% of traffic for the Brindlemoor routes. Sandbox uses synthetic rider data, so don't panic about what you see there. All toggles live in one config set. The current values for prod-canary are listed below.

deployment values, tafog-kagap:
wenath:
  pin: 4244
  metrics_host: metrics.wenath.lumicsys.internal
  tenant: istix
  seal: seal_10585894

Subject: Key rotation — replica lag alarm

Heads up: the credential used by the Lagwatch alarm to query the Fenwick read-replica metrics endpoint was rotated this morning. The old key stops working at 18:00 UTC. Update the on-call runbook config before then so alerts keep firing. The new key is below.

service key, tadup-tahog: zpat7_wB1tnEL

## Further Reading

The Ladlecraft scaling engine converts recipe quantities using per-ingredient density tables, so plugin authors should not hardcode volume-to-weight ratios. Custom units must be registered before the scaler runs, and yield adjustments are applied after unit normalization. Examples covering batch multipliers, pan-size conversion, and rounding rules are included in the developer cookbook, which lives on our internal docs page here.

wiki page, tahaf-tajog: https://jira.ordindyn.corp/pipeline

Artifact Signing — Validata Plugin System

All validator plugins published to the Validata registry must be signed before upload. Unsigned bundles are rejected at ingest. Use the CLI's sign command against your built archive, then verify locally before submitting. The registry checks your signature against our published trust root. For verification, the current registry signing key follows:

release key, yagap-kagag: bky6_1ks93y